Market Overview

The market for intracranial stents is witnessing significant growth and is expected to expand at a steady rate in the coming years. Intracranial stents are medical devices used in the treatment of various neurological conditions, particularly those affecting the blood vessels in the brain. These stents are designed to provide support, improve blood flow, and prevent blockages in the intracranial arteries, thereby reducing the risk of stroke and other cerebrovascular diseases.

Meaning

Intracranial stents are metallic or polymeric tubes that are inserted into the blood vessels of the brain to treat conditions such as intracranial stenosis, aneurysms, and arteriovenous malformations. These stents act as scaffolds, helping to keep the blood vessels open and improving the overall blood circulation in the brain. They are typically used in conjunction with other interventional procedures, such as angioplasty or coil embolization, to provide better patient outcomes.

Market Restraints

Despite the promising outlook, the Intracranial Stents Total Addressable Market faces several challenges:

  1. High Procedural Costs: The high cost of stenting procedures, which includes the cost of the stent itself, hospital fees, and physician charges, may limit adoption, particularly in low- and middle-income countries.
  2. Risk of Complications: While minimally invasive, intracranial stenting still carries the risk of complications such as clot formation, restenosis, and device migration, which can deter patient and clinician adoption.
  3. Limited Awareness in Certain Regions: In some developing regions, there may be limited awareness or access to intracranial stenting procedures, limiting market penetration.
  4. Reimbursement Challenges: In some regions, reimbursement for stenting procedures may be limited or complicated, which can affect the affordability and accessibility of these treatments.

Segmentation

The Intracranial Stents Total Addressable Market can be segmented based on various factors to provide insights into its structure:

  1. By Product Type:
    • Self-Expanding Stents: These stents automatically expand after deployment, commonly used in intracranial procedures.
    • Balloon-Expandable Stents: These require inflation to expand after placement, suitable for specific conditions.
  2. By Application:
    • Ischemic Stroke Treatment: Used to treat ischemic strokes caused by narrowing or blockage of brain arteries.
    • Aneurysm Treatment: Intracranial stents are also used in treating brain aneurysms by providing support to the blood vessel walls.
    • Vascular Malformations: Stents help to address abnormal blood vessel structures in the brain, reducing the risk of bleeding or stroke.
